Hiring a handyman is one of the easiest ways to tackle those home repairs and maintenance tasks that never seem to get done. Whether you need help with small repairs, property maintenance, or odd jobs around the house, a little planning can help you get the most value from your handyman’s visit.
Here’s my top five tips to make your appointment as efficient and cost-effective as possible.
1. Create a list of jobs
Before your handyman arrives, take a walk around your property and make a note of all the jobs you’d like completed.
Common Handyman Tasks Include
- Hanging shelves, mirrors, and pictures
- Repairing doors and locks
- Fixing dripping taps
- Replacing silicone sealant
- Flat-pack furniture assembly
- Minor decorating repairs
- Fence and gate repairs
- General home maintenance tasks
Combining several small jobs into one visit can often save time and money, helping you get better value from your handyman service.
2. Make Sure Materials Are Ready
If your project requires specific parts or materials, it’s helpful to have them available before work begins. For larger or more specialised jobs, ask for a quotation in advance so your handyman can advise exactly what materials will be needed.
3. Provide Plenty of Detail When Booking
When making an enquiry, include as much information as possible about the work required. Photos are particularly helpful for repairs and maintenance jobs.
Why Detailed Information Helps
- More accurate estimates
- Better scheduling
- Correct tools and materials brought to the job
- Fewer unexpected delays
4. Book Ahead Where Possible
Many homeowners only think about repairs when they become urgent. However, experienced handymen are often booked several weeks in advance, particularly during busy periods.
5. Prepare the Work Area
A little preparation before your handyman arrives can make a big difference. Clear access to the work area by moving furniture, ornaments, vehicles, or other obstacles where appropriate.
Frequently Asked Questions
How many jobs can a handyman do in one visit?
Most handymen can complete several small tasks during a single appointment, depending on the time required and whether materials are available.
Should I provide materials for a handyman?
It depends on the job. Some customers prefer to purchase materials themselves, while others ask the handyman to supply them.
How far in advance should I book a handyman?
Booking two to four weeks ahead is often recommended, especially during busy periods.
